Abstract

In general, at the relationship between claim and obligation if debtor does not fulfill its obligations arbitrarily the creditor can claim to debtor such as lawsuit. It means, despite the debtor ordered payment through the judgment, if debtor disobey that judgment, compulsory execution can be performed by the force of the country. In the end, fulfillment of obligation is enforced by national authorities in principle. However, exceptionally, even it established as a valid debt, if debtors fulfill themselves, they may not be protected from the national authorities. That is the natural obligation. The natural obligation originated from the Roman law which enforces strict type legal system and it is exceptional phenomenon in modern civil law which is made up as that all the bonds are likely to recourse. Therefore, in Korean theory acknowledge that debt is natural obligation and there is no exception. However, there are still controversy about the presence and occurrence of natural obligation. So, in this paper, want to review about its extent and effect including the concept of natural obligation.
